LANSING, Mich. (AP) — A judge has ruled that independent presidential candidate Cornel West must appear on the Michigan ballot. The decision Saturday came about a week after West was disqualified.  The state disqualified West because the affidavit of identity he submitted was not properly notarized. But Michigan Court of Claims Judge James Robert Redford says West’s campaign submitted the proper number of signatures to qualify.  A spokesperson for Michigan's secretary of state said the office will appeal.
